KINETIC, the conductorless ensemble

This week’s episode of Encore Houston features KINETIC, the conductorless ensemble and their most recent concert: Duos, Dances & Divertimenti. The concert features works by two generations of Finnish composers: Rautavaara and Mustonen, as well as noted folk music enthusiast Bela Bartok.

Music in this episode:

  • EINOJUHANI RAUTAVAARA, Pelimannit (The Fiddlers)
  • OLLI MUSTONEN, Sinuhe
  • BELA BARTOK, Romanian Folk Dances and excerpts from Duos for Two Violins
  • BARTOK, Divertimento for String Orchestra
  • Encore: BENJAMIN BRITTEN, Three Divertimenti
    • MuChen Hsieh, violin
    • Mark Chien, violin
    • Tonya Burton, viola
    • Nathan Watts, cello
  • Performance date: 10/15/2017
  • Originally aired: 1/13/2018
